Writing a Literature Review A literature review is a specific type of academic essay that gives a critical summary of the available scholarly articles, books, and other sources that pertain to a chosen research area, topic, or theory. The author of the literature review takes a step beyond simply summarizing the literature and adds critical evaluations and synthesis of the themes found across the literature. Writing a literature review is often the first step taken before conducting a research project. Scholarly articles describing original research begin with a review of the literature regarding the topic, then go on to describe the experiment or study in detail. A literature review can also be the first step in writing a research paper. It helps you, the writer, organize your research into themes. Organizing your Literature Review Similar to many academic papers, literature reviews have 3 basic elements: an introduction, a body, and a conclusion. Introduction You will define your topic and establish the purpose of the literature review in the introduction. This is where you will introduce your research question. Body You will discuss the articles as they relate to each theme you’ve chosen. Each paragraph should discuss one specific theme and discuss all of the articles that support or refute that theme. Useful language to connect articles within the paragraph include: ‘One trend in the research is…’, ‘Studies show that…’, ‘There is disagreement among scholars about…’ Use subheads to organize the body of your paper into approx. three themes that summarize the different elements of the research you’ve gathered. Be sure to discuss how the literature you’re summarizing relates back to your specific research question. How will this research help you make predictions/ hypotheses related to your own research question. The writing should be in your own words as much as possible. Keeps quotations from sources to a minimum. Conclusion You will summarize the themes you discussed in the body of your paper. You will also discuss areas of controversy in the literature. Finally, you will discuss the gaps in the research and identify areas that need further study. References The references section has the full citations of the resources you discuss in your paper presented in APA style (Links to an external site.). This will be on a separate page from the rest of your paper.
